How to Change Your Team Name on PL Fantasy Football: A Step-by-Step Guide

1. Log in to your PL Fantasy Football account: Visit the official Premier League Fantasy Football website or app and log in using your credentials.
2. Navigate to your team page: Once you’re logged in, click on the “My Team” tab. This will take you to your team’s homepage.
3. Locate the “Edit Team” button: On your team page, you’ll find an “Edit Team” button. It’s typically located near the top or bottom of the page.
4. Click on the “Edit Team” button: This will open a pop-up window or take you to a new page where you can edit your team’s details.
5. Change your team name: Within the “Edit Team” section, you’ll see a field labeled “Team Name.” Click on the current name to highlight it, then type in your desired new name.
6. Save your changes: Once you’ve entered your new team name, click on the “Save” or “Update” button. Your team name will be changed instantly.

Common Questions and Answers

Q: Can I change my team name more than once during the season?

A: Yes, you can change your team name as many times as you like throughout the season.

Q: What happens to my team’s ranking if I change the name?

A: Changing your team name will not affect your team’s ranking in the league. Your team’s performance and points will remain the same.

Q: Can I use offensive or inappropriate language for my team name?

A: It’s best to avoid using offensive or inappropriate language for your team name. PL Fantasy Football has guidelines for acceptable team names, and you may face penalties if you violate them.

Q: Can I change my team name during a live gameweek?

A: Yes, you can change your team name at any time, even during a live gameweek. However, if you change your name after the deadline for the current gameweek, the change will not be reflected on the leaderboard until the next gameweek begins.
